BringBackDoves · 13/11/2019 08:01
Sedona - close to Phoenix, quirky, beautiful, great hiking around Oak Creek Canyon
Flagstaff - lovely college town, lots of lovely cafes and restaurants, close to places like Meteor Crater, Sunset Crater etc
Obvs Grand Canyon lovely but you wouldn’t scratch the surface
Canyon De Chelly is beautiful but smaller than the GC and has great hiking
loofa · 13/11/2019 08:09
Antelope Canyon - it's the orange sandstone slot canyon that gets used on so many screen savers and indents. It's a-maz-ing and you have to go there with Navajo people, which brings some other insights.
Second Flagstaff, cool and quirky, plus there's a perfectly preserved meteor crater just outside of you're in to that sort of thing.
